Linux 常见用法

权限类型一般包括读,写,执行。对应字母为 r=4、w=2、x=1
eg:chmod -R 777 filename 最高权限
用FTP上传的文件一般都是 root:root 要改成 www:www;
chowm www:www -R 文件目录;加-R代表遍历修改该目录下的所有,不加的时候代表只修改自己。

打开文件: vim filename
编辑文件:i
退出编辑:Esc 按钮
【:w】 保存编辑的内容
【:w!】强制写入该文件,但跟你对该文件的权限有关
【:q】 离开vi
【:q!】 不想保存修改强制离开
【:wq】 保存后离开
【:x】 保存后离开
保存编辑::wq;
显示行数:set nu
不显示行数:set nonu
向下滚动:先按住Esc,然后在一直按J
重命名:mv 原文件名 新文件名
复制粘贴文件:cp [选项] 源文件或目录 目标文件或目录
剪切粘贴文件:mv [选项] 源文件或目录 目标文件或目录

删除文件    rm 文件      慎用 rm -rf
删除文件的时候:rm: cannot remove `.user.ini’: Operation not permitted;
原因:文件属性, lsattr -a可以查看文件属性,其中 -i :设定文件不能被删除、改名、设定链接关系,同时不能写入或新增内容。i参数对于文件 系统的安全设置有很大帮助。
解决:在user.ini目录下执行 chattr -i .user.ini; 因为chattr可以改变文件的属性,让他可以被删除

打包 :tar -cvf 打包后的文件名 源文件名 eg: tar -cvf name.tar filename (可以不要cvf中的v)
打包并压缩:tar 打包后的文件名 原文件名 eg:tar -zcvf name.tar.gz filename (可以不要zcvf中的v)
解包 :tar -xvf 指定解包文件 eg: tar -xvf name.tar 或 tar -xvf name.tar.gz (可以不要xvf中的v)

在这里插入图片描述
所以打、解包不加 v 比较 “干净” tar -cf name.tar file.name tar -xf name.tar
.tar 只负责打包,gz负责压缩 tar -zcf name.tar.gz

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值